Are there organ concerts at Palma Cathedral, and when can visitors attend them?

Locals tend to appreciate the combination of music and history that the organ concerts at La Seu, Palma’s stunning Gothic cathedral, offer throughout the year. These concerts highlight the grandeur of the cathedral's famous pipe organ, one of the finest on the island. Performances usually include classical pieces that resonate beautifully within the soaring stone and stained glass walls, creating an unforgettable atmosphere.

Concerts are often scheduled on weekends, especially during heightened cultural periods like Holy Week or the Feast of Sant Sebastià in January. During the warmer months, a series of summer concerts attracts visitors who combine their love of music with exploring Palma’s historic old town. Since the program can vary, it’s best to consult the cathedral’s official website or the Palma tourism office for the current timetable. Attending an organ recital here offers a unique way to experience a blend of musical artistry and Mallorcan heritage in the heart of the island’s capital.
